What Exactly Are Social Accounts?

These accounts are user profiles across different social networks like Facebook, Instagram, Twitter, LinkedIn, YouTube, and TikTok, among others. These may be profiles used for personal, business, or influencer purposes that have gained an audience, user engagement, and various forms of content. When acquiring a social media account, you take control of a pre-built profile that has an existing following, likes, and may even have a recognized brand.

Possible Issues When Acquiring Social Accounts

Although the positives are evident, there are also potential pitfalls:

1. Scammers and Fraud: Fraud is a significant risk when buying accounts. Often, accounts are sold with non-genuine followers or the seller could reclaim the account later.

2. Platform Rules: Most social networks have rules against selling accounts. If you’re caught, the account can be permanently banned or deleted, which means you’ll lose the money spent.

3. Low Interaction: An account with thousands of followers doesn’t guarantee engagement. Followers could be fake, inactive, or uninterested, resulting in poor engagement.
